Wang Chunting first took out a patchwork quilt of various colors, her eyes gentle, "Youzhi was born weak, so I went to ask for a patchwork quilt for him. I hope all his illnesses will be cured."

The quilt was made of scraps of cloth, pieced together bit by bit according to color and shape. Each scrap of cloth was only the size of a palm.

Everyone was moved after watching it.

As the name suggests, a quilt is made by going to one hundred families to get scraps of cloth, and then sewing them into a quilt bit by bit by hand according to size and shape.

It is said that if a child is prone to illness, covering himself with a quilt will allow him to live to the age of ninety-nine without any illness or disaster.

Everything was in short supply these days. Even scraps of cloth were used to dip starch into the soles of shoes. It was not an easy task to beg for scraps of cloth from door to door.

If you are rejected, you can only go to the next house. If you want to succeed, you have to beg at least a hundred houses.

The effort and time spent on it are both visible to the naked eye.
